The results also show that the decrease in the concentration of
the cellobiose-fructose was in correlation with an increase in the
concentration of cellobiose-sucrose that achieved amaximum concentration
of 3.05% (2.36 g/L) and 2.13% (3.31 g/L) at 12 and 48 h,
respectively, in maple syrup 15◦Bx and 30 ◦Bx-based systems. An
increase in the levan yield as the reaction proceeded from 12 to 48 h,
was also obtained reaching a yield of 12.42% (9.62 g/L) and 7.39%
(11.45 g/L) at 48 h in maple syrup 15◦Bx and 30◦Bx-based systems,respectively. These resultsmayreveal the use of cellobiose-fructose
as an acceptor and explained partially the decrease of its concentration
at the late stage of reaction. The shift of reaction equilibrium
toward the hydrolysis may also explain the decrease of cellobiosefructose
concentration.
